Are you talking about the circulation pump attached to the front center of the engine, or the "raw water pump" near the lower right front corner of the engine? The circulation pump may have a shaft seal that leaks and drips out of a hole on the bottom of that pump. The impeller does not need to be changed. The raw water pump does have a replaceable rubber impeller. That pump can be more challenging. There are 3 or 4 screws holding the back cover plate on that pump. The impeller can be removed and replaced rather easily once you can get to it. Can the front and sides of the box surrounding the engine be removed?
